Automation Controls Specialist

4 months ago


Louisville, United States Nucor Corporation Full time
Job Details

Division: Nucor Tubular - Louisville

Location: Louisville, KY, United States

Other Available Locations: N/A

Basic Job Functions:

The role of the Automation Technician is to work with the Maintenance and Production teams to maximize the safety of and to maintain and optimize the processes. This will include using engineering principles, algorithms and techniques to trouble-shoot and improve both the process and equipment and to develop/implement future improvement plans. The teammate must be able to support the integration of robots into custom designed manufacturing cells and fabrication processes. This will include both hardware and software and will likely require additional support outside normal business hours. Must be willing to work a flexible schedule, including scheduled and unscheduled overtime, weekends, and holidays as scheduled. This position is regional in nature and will require regular travel to other Nucor locations to proactively find improvement opportunities as well as to help solve existing problems, train other team members, assist with regional maintenance and to learn/share best practices. This position is not limited to only these responsibilities, the area Supervisor/Manager may add responsibilities as needed.

Responsibilities
  • Install, maintain, and upgrade automation systems at key points in the production process
  • Troubleshoot non-functioning components including servos, sensors, and control components
  • Program and troubleshoot PLCs, HMIs, and robotic systems
  • Attend automation, robotics, and equipment supplier training
Safety is the most important part of all jobs within Nucor; therefore, candidates must be able to demonstrate the ability to initiate, lead, and uphold safety policies, practices, procedures, and housekeeping standards at all times.

Minimum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in a STEM field or equivalent work experience
  • Diverse background in PLCs, HMIs, and industrial controls
  • Ability to travel for training and alignment with the other NTS sites
  • Minimum of 2 years of experience working in industrial maintenance.
  • Good understanding of overall maintenance process and electrical principles including the following:
    • Networking tools and standards
    • Ability to interpret electrical schematics for installation, repair, and maintaining equipment
    • Basic pneumatic and hydraulic system knowledge
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Experience with Siemens and Allen-Bradley PLCs, HMIs, and drives
  • Experience with robots
  • Knowledge of communication protocols like, Profinet, Profibus, Ethernet IP, and, Modbus
  • 1 - 2 years of PLC experience
  • 2 - 3 years of experience in a manufacturing environment
  • Good understanding of overall maintenance process and electrical principle
